How much do restaurant line cook j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for restaurant line cook in Michigan is $13.49,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$11.73 and $15.10 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are restaurant line cooks?

Restaurant line cooks are culinary professionals responsible for preparing, cooking, and plating food items according to a restaurant's recipes and standards. They work on the 'line,' which is the area of the kitchen where food is assembled, and often specialize in specific stations such as grill, sauté, or fryer. Line cooks must work quickly and efficiently, especially during busy meal times, and maintain high standards of food safety and cleanliness. They are essential members of the kitchen team and help ensure that every dish meets the restaurant's quality expectations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Restaurant Line Cook,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Restaurant Line Cook, you need strong culinary skills, attention to detail, and a solid understanding of food safety and sanitation, often supported by prior kitchen experience or culinary training. Familiarity with commercial kitchen equipment, point-of-sale (POS) systems, and food safety certifications like ServSafe is typically required. Excellent time management, teamwork, and the ability to stay calm under pressure are standout soft skills in this role. These abilities are vital to ensure consistent food quality, operational efficiency, and a positive dining experience for customers.

What is the difference between Restaurant Line Cook vs Kitchen Prep Cook?

AspectRestaurant Line CookKitchen Prep Cook
ResponsibilitiesPrepares menu items during service, follows recipes, manages stationPrepares ingredients, washes, chops, and organizes supplies
Work EnvironmentFast-paced kitchen during service hoursPre-shift, slower pace, prep area
CredentialsBasic culinary skills, kitchen experience often preferredBasic knife skills, food safety knowledge
Industry UsageCommonly employed in restaurants during serviceTypically works in prep stations, supporting line cooks

The main difference between a Restaurant Line Cook and a Kitchen Prep Cook lies in their roles during restaurant service. Line cooks actively prepare dishes during busy hours, while prep cooks focus on preparing ingredients beforehand. Both roles require culinary skills and food safety knowledge, but line cooks usually have more experience and work in a faster-paced environment.

What are some common challenges faced by restaurant line cooks, and how can they be managed?

Restaurant line cooks often work in fast-paced, high-pressure environments where multitasking and time management are essential. Challenges include handling multiple orders simultaneously, maintaining consistency in presentation and taste, and adapting to sudden changes such as menu updates or staff shortages. Effective communication with team members and staying organized can help manage these pressures. Regular practice, a focus on teamwork, and a willingness to learn from feedback are key to thriving in this role.
